    Americans’ Challenges with Health Care Costs – KFF

    Understanding the financial burden of health care in the United States and how KFF research sheds light on this pressing issue.

    Introduction: Why Health Care Costs Are a Critical Concern for Americans

    Health care costs are a growing concern for millions of Americans, impacting everything from family budgets to national policy debates. According to research by the Kaiser Family Foundation (KFF), the rising expenses associated with medical care are creating widespread financial stress and barriers to accessing necessary treatments. Understanding these challenges is crucial not only for patients but also for policymakers, employers, and health care providers aiming to improve affordability and outcomes.

    Key Findings From KFF on Americans’ Health Care Cost Challenges

    KFF’s extensive research highlights several prominent issues Americans face regarding health care costs. Below are some of the most significant findings:

    • High Out-of-Pocket Expenses: Many Americans struggle with copays, deductibles, and other direct expenses that often exceed their budgets.
    • Medical Debt Prevalence: Over 40% of adults report having trouble paying medical bills or are currently paying down medical debt.
    • Insurance Coverage Gaps: Even insured individuals encounter significant cost-sharing burdens that limit their access to care.
    • Delayed or Forgone Care: To avoid high expenses, many postpone or skip necessary medical treatments, potentially worsening health outcomes.
    • Variation by Income and Demographics: Low-income and minority groups are disproportionately affected by health care cost pressures.

    Table: Snapshot of Financial Challenges Faced by Americans (Source: KFF)

    Challenge Percentage of Adults Affected Additional Notes
    Trouble Paying Medical Bills 43% Includes owing money or past-due payments
    Medical Debt Carrying 33% Currently paying off debts from medical care
    Delayed Care Due to Cost 27% Skipped or postponed health services

    Why Do Health Care Costs Pose Such Difficulty for Americans?

    Several factors contribute to the financial difficulties Americans face regarding health care:

    • Rising Prices: Prices for hospital care, prescription drugs, and medical procedures have escalated faster than wages and inflation.
    • Insurance Complexity: Varied plans with high deductibles and coinsurance leave many responsible for substantial out-of-pocket costs.
    • Chronic Conditions: The prevalence of chronic illnesses requires ongoing treatment, compounding expenses for individuals and families.
    • Limited Price Transparency: Patients often lack clear information on costs before receiving care, hindering budgeting and choice.

    Impact on Different Groups: Who Bears the Brunt?

    Health care cost challenges are not uniform. Certain groups face intensified financial pressure:

    • Low-Income Families: Struggle with affordability even for basic health care services.
    • Uninsured and Underinsured: At risk for catastrophic costs and medical debt.
    • Seniors and Disabled Individuals: Often require expensive ongoing care and medications.
    • Minority Populations: Experience disparities in access and financial strain due to systemic obstacles.

    Practical Tips to Manage Health Care Costs

    Managing health care expenses can be challenging, but these strategies can help Americans reduce financial strain:

    • Understand Your Insurance Plan: Know your deductible, copays, and out-of-pocket limits to anticipate annual costs.
    • Use Preventive Care: Take advantage of free or low-cost screenings and vaccines to prevent expensive illnesses.
    • Compare Prices: Shop around for procedures or prescriptions when possible, using available price transparency tools.
    • Negotiate Bills: Ask providers about payment plans or discounts for upfront payments or financial hardship.
    • Utilize Assistance Programs: Explore state and federal programs or charitable resources for help with medical bills.

    Policy Solutions KFF Recommends to Address Health Care Costs

    KFF highlights several policy approaches aimed at making health care more affordable:

    • Expanding Medicaid coverage and subsidies under the Affordable Care Act.
    • Regulating surprise medical billing to protect patients.
    • Promoting transparency in health care pricing.
    • Encouraging value-based care models that focus on outcomes rather than volume.
    • Supporting prescription drug pricing reforms to lower medication costs.
